Marco Di Maio is a scholar working on Cardiology and Cardiovascular Medicine, Pulmonary and Respiratory Medicine and Surgery. According to data from OpenAlex, Marco Di Maio has authored 94 papers receiving a total of 1.2k indexed citations (citations by other indexed papers that have themselves been cited), including 55 papers in Cardiology and Cardiovascular Medicine, 28 papers in Pulmonary and Respiratory Medicine and 26 papers in Surgery. Recurrent topics in Marco Di Maio's work include Cardiovascular Function and Risk Factors (16 papers), Atrial Fibrillation Management and Outcomes (14 papers) and COVID-19 Clinical Research Studies (13 papers). Marco Di Maio is often cited by papers focused on Cardiovascular Function and Risk Factors (16 papers), Atrial Fibrillation Management and Outcomes (14 papers) and COVID-19 Clinical Research Studies (13 papers). Marco Di Maio collaborates with scholars based in Italy, United States and United Kingdom. Marco Di Maio's co-authors include Angelo Silverio, Gennaro Galasso, Vincenzo Russo, Carmine Vecchione, Rodolfo Citro, Renato De Vecchis, Fernando Scudiero, Antonello D’Andrea, Emilio Attena and Luca Esposito and has published in prestigious journals such as Journal of Clinical Oncology, European Heart Journal and The American Journal of Cardiology.
